For Lease Stephanie Deering For Lease – 144 Lincoln Street, Cambridge, MA 144 Lincoln Street, Cambridge, MA Price Negotiable Office 19,782 SF Bldg
For Lease Stephanie Deering For Lease – 86 Kirkland St, Cambridge, MA 86 Kirkland St, Cambridge, MA Price Negotiable Office 3,011 SF Bldg
For Lease Stephanie Deering For Lease – 265 Medford Street, Somerville, MA 265 Medford Street, Somerville, MA Price Negotiable Office 27,244 SF Bldg
For Lease Stephanie Deering For Lease – 23 Broadway, Arlington, MA 23 Broadway, Arlington, MA Price Negotiable Office 11,418 SF Bldg